Ambrose Appelbe sponsors Andreas Scholl and OAE
Ambrose Appelbe were sponsors of a concert given by the Orchestra of the Age of Enlightenment on 11 June at the Royal Festival Hall. Called Celebrating the countertenor, the programme included arias by Handel, Vivaldi and Bach sung by counter-tenor Andreas Scholl, and Bach suites played by the OAE. The BBC will broadcast the concert on Radio 3 on 20 June at 7pm.
